HOUSE BILL NO. 67

INTRODUCED BY PAVLOVICH B



A BILL FOR AN ACT ENTITLED: "AN ACT PROVIDING AN APPROPRIATION FOR A FULL-TIME EMPLOYEE AT THE STATE VETERANS' CEMETERY AT FORT HARRISON; AND PROVIDING AN EFFECTIVE DATE."



B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F MONTANA:



     NEW SECTION.  Section 1.  Appropriation. There is appropriated from the general fund to the department of military affairs for the biennium ending June 30, 2001, $15,000 for the purposes of providing a full-time employee to support the state veterans' cemetery at Fort Harrison.



     NEW SECTION.  Section 2.  Effective date. [This act] is effective July 1, 1999.
